
Following congratulatory messages from Diddy, Pharrell, L.A. Reid, and Sidney Poitier, Jermaine Dupri kicked off the tribute by mixing some of the hits he produced for Mariah. Joe belted out “We Belong Together,” gospel star Karen Clark-Sheard soared with “Anytime You Need a Friend,” Eric BenĂ©t dueted on “One Sweet Day,” and Fantasia tore the house down with a soulful version of “Hero.”
With Nick by her side, a gracious Mariah accepted the honor. “I’m just humbled and thankful and grateful,” said Mimi. “Thank you for blessing me with this moment.”
Nas opened the show with a four-song medley including “Daughters” and “Bye Baby,” and Future had the crowd singing along to his ubiquitous hit “Same Damn Time.”
Drake and Lil Wayne shared Songwriter of the Year honors, while Nicki Minaj’s “Super Bass” took home Song of the Year. Pop Wansel (Nicki Minaj, Elle Varner) was presented with Producer of the Year.
